  2. Sorry, this is what I was trying to say.

    I do have a soft boot setup as well and ride at +15 front and +9 Rear, but what I saw yesterday was mostly about +15 front and -15 rear.

    If you were to align your hips with front binding angle I feel it would really twist the rear hip in an unnatural position.

    I used to be an instructor about 7 years ago and if a board came out of the rental shop like that it was sent back to be fixed.

    Is this just another push towards everyone being a halfpipe rider and not all mountain.

    Not trying to stir **** up just something I noticed more this year over last.

    I have never even tried a pipe, I rode all mountain duckie and at the time it felt right :biggthump
